PASCO COUNTY, Fla. — The US Coast Guard said a man who went missing while kayaking near Anclote Park was found safe on Tuesday.

Stephan Bungartz, 36, reportedly told officials that he dropped his phone in the water and didn't have a way to contact friends or family.

The Pasco County Sheriff's Office said Bungartz went missing around 4 p.m. on Monday in the Gulfview Drive area of New Port Richey.

He was last seen launching his kayak from the clubhouse just north of Anclote Park before he was found safe.
